Getting new contact lenses from Costco can be a convenient and cost-effective option. However, the processing time can vary depending on several factors. This article will guide you through the typical timeframe and what might influence it.

Understanding the Costco Contact Lens Process

Costco's optical department offers a wide selection of contact lenses from various brands. The process generally involves an eye exam (if needed), ordering your contacts, and then waiting for them to arrive.

1. Eye Exam

If you need an eye exam, scheduling this appointment will be the first step. Availability varies by location and optometrist schedule. Expect to book your appointment in advance, potentially a week or two depending on demand. The exam itself takes about 30-45 minutes.

2. Ordering Your Contacts

After your eye exam (or if you're bringing a valid prescription), choosing your lenses and placing your order is the next step. This process usually takes only a few minutes within the optical department.

3. Processing and Delivery Time

This is where the wait time comes in. The time it takes to receive your contacts after ordering depends on several factors:

  • Lens Availability: Common brands and types of lenses usually ship quickly. However, specialized lenses or those less frequently ordered might take longer to obtain. This could add several days to the wait time.

  • Costco's Inventory: The specific Costco warehouse also plays a role. If your selected lenses are in stock at your local warehouse, you might get them the same day or within a day or two. If they need to be ordered from a distribution center, it will take longer.

  • Shipping Method: Costco may offer different shipping options, impacting delivery time. Faster shipping will obviously result in quicker arrival.

Typical Timeframe: In most cases, you can expect to receive your contact lenses within 3 to 7 business days after placing your order. However, this is just an estimate.

Factors Affecting Wait Time

  • Lens Type: Specialty or custom contacts often require more time for manufacturing and processing.

  • Time of Year: Demand can fluctuate seasonally, potentially leading to longer wait times during peak periods.

  • Warehouse Location: Some Costco locations might experience delays due to logistical challenges or staffing levels.

What to Do if Your Contacts are Delayed

If your contact lenses are taking significantly longer than expected, several actions can be taken:

  • Contact Costco Optical: Call your local Costco Optical department to inquire about the status of your order. They can provide an updated estimated delivery date or explain any potential delays.

  • Check Your Order Status: If you ordered online, check your order status through your Costco account.

  • Consider Alternatives: If you need contacts urgently and face a considerable delay, explore temporary solutions such as using your existing lenses for a bit longer. (Always follow your eye doctor's advice on lens usage.)
